The heart pumps blood into the arteries with enough force to push blood to the far reaches of each organ from the top of the head to the bottom of the feet. Blood pressure can be defined as the pressure of blood on the walls of the arteries as it circulates through the body. Blood pressure is highest as its leaves the heart through the aorta and gradually decreases as it enters smaller and smaller blood vessels (arteries, arterioles, and capillaries). Blood returns in the veins leading to the heart, aided by gravity and muscle contraction.

Hypertension can be controlled by outpatient means by either medication or lifestyle change. When someone is admitted to a hospital due to complications from hypertension, then preventative measures could have failed. However, the cause of failure is not represented here, and that can include both patient and provider based causes.
Prevention is an important role for all healthcare providers. Hypertension is a controllable condition using outpatient care and drug therapy. Prevention Quality Indicators (PQIs) are a set of measures that help identify quality of care for outpatient and other non-hospital care.

Chronic Obstructive Pulmonary Disease (COPD) is an umbrella term used to describe progressive lung diseases including emphysema, chronic bronchitis, refractory (non-reversible) asthma, and some forms of bronchiectasis. This disease is characterized by increasing breathlessness.
COPD affects an estimated 30 million individuals in the U.S., and over half of them have symptoms of COPD and do not know it. Early screening can identify COPD before major loss of lung function occurs.
Most cases of COPD are caused by inhaling pollutants; that includes smoking (cigarettes, pipes, cigars, etc.), and second-hand smoke.
Fumes, chemicals and dust found in many work environments are contributing factors for many individuals who develop COPD.
Genetics can also play a role in an individual’s development of COPD—even if the person has never smoked or has ever been exposed to strong lung irritants in the workplace.

How to Calculate PQI #3: Diabetes Long-term Complications Admission Rate
Diabetes is a complicated disease. But don’t confuse this thought with the term “diabetes complications”! Complications generally occur after years of high blood glucose. The blood vessels become damaged unless you can keep your glucose levels in a healthy range most of the time. The range of complications span from being simply annoying to actually life threatening. The lesser conditions include dry and itchy skin, mild gum disease, a tendency to be more susceptible to colds and flu, and in women, yeast infections. The more serious complications - some life-changing or life-threatening - include eye disease, kidney disease, nerve disease and heart disease.

How to Calculate PQI #2: Perforated Appendix Admission Rate
A perforated appendix is one of the complications of acute appendicitis. If appendicitis is left untreated, ischemic necrosis of a portion of appendiceal wall may occur, leading to perforation. An appendicolith is thought to be associated with a higher probability of perforation. Perforation of the appendix is more common among the elderly population due to an increased frequency of late and atypical presentation of appendicitis, delay in diagnosis, delayed decision for surgery and to the age-specific physiological changes.
Population Measured (Denominator)
Discharges, for patients ages 18 years and older, with any-listed ICD-CM diagnosis codes for appendicitis. Discharges are assigned to the denominator based on the metropolitan area or county of the patient residence, not the metropolitan area or county of the hospital where the discharge occurred.

How to Calculate PQI #1 Diabetes Short-Term Complications Admission Rate
Population Measured (Denominator)After applying the exclusions outlined in the next section, all inpatient utilization of the member were counted. Percentage can be counted based on the member count or by the IP admit count.
Beneficiaries are excluded from the population measured if they:
• were under the age of 18
• were enrolled in Medicare managed care (a Medicare Advantage plan) for any month during the performance period
• were enrolled in Medicare Part A only or Medicare Part B only for any month during the performance period
• resided outside of the United States, its territories, and its possessions for any month during the performance period
• Hospitalizations are excluded from the measure outcome if:
• the hospital admission is a transfer from a hospital, skilled nursing facility, intermediate care facility, or other health care facility
• the hospitalization is missing a principal diagnosis
• the discharge had any diagnosis code for sickle-cell anemia or HB-S disease, or any diagnosis or procedure code for immunocompromised state (bacterial pneumonia
component measure only)
• the discharge had any diagnosis code for kidney/urinary tract disorder or any diagnosis or procedure code for immunocompromised state (urinary tract infection component measure only)
• the discharge had any diagnosis code for chronic renal failure (dehydration component measure only)
NUMERATOR:
ICD-9-CM Description
250.10 Diabetes with ketoacidosis, type II or unspecified type, not stated as uncontrolled
250.11 Diabetes with ketoacidosis, type I [juvenile type], not stated as uncontrolled
250.12 Diabetes with ketoacidosis, type II or unspecified type, uncontrolled
250.13 Diabetes with ketoacidosis, type I [juvenile type], uncontrolled
250.20 Diabetes with hyperosmolarity, type II or unspecified type, not stated as uncontrolled
250.21 Diabetes with hyperosmolarity, type I [juvenile type], not stated as uncontrolled
250.22 Diabetes with hyperosmolarity, type II or unspecified type, uncontrolled
250.23 Diabetes with hyperosmolarity, type I [juvenile type], uncontrolled
250.30 Diabetes with other coma, type II or unspecified type, not stated as uncontrolled
250.31 Diabetes with other coma, type I [juvenile type], not stated as uncontrolled
250.32 Diabetes with other coma, type II or unspecified type, uncontrolled
250.33 Diabetes with other coma, type I [juvenile type], uncontrolled
ICD-10-CM Description
E10.10 Type 1 diabetes mellitus with ketoacidosis without coma
E10.11 Type 1 diabetes mellitus with ketoacidosis with coma
E10.641 Type 1 diabetes mellitus with hypoglycemia with coma
E10.65 Type 1 diabetes mellitus with hyperglycemia
E11.00 Type 2 diabetes mellitus with hyperosmolarity without nonketotic hyperglycemic-hyperosmolar coma (NKHHC)
E11.01 Type 2 diabetes mellitus with hyperosmolarity with coma
E11.641 Type 2 diabetes mellitus with hypoglycemia with coma
E11.65 Type 2 diabetes mellitus with hyperglycemia
E13.00 Other specified diabetes mellitus with hyperosmolarity without nonketotic hyperglycemic-hyperosmolar coma (NKHHC)
E13.01 Other specified diabetes mellitus with hyperosmolarity with coma
E13.10 Other specified diabetes mellitus with ketoacidosis without coma
E13.11 Other specified diabetes mellitus with ketoacidosis with coma
E13.641 Other specified diabetes mellitus with hypoglycemia with coma
NUMERATOR Exclude cases:
•transfer from a hospital (different facility)
•transfer from a skilled Nursing Facility (SNF) or Intermediate Care Facility (ICF)
•transfer from another health care facility
•MDC 14 (pregnancy, childbirth, and puerperium)

Know About Ambulatory-Care-Sensitive Admissions or PQI
Ambulatory-Care-Sensitive Admissions (ACSAs) are those that can be
prevented. This is also commonly known as Prevention Quality Indicators or in
short ‘PQI’.
The Agency for Healthcare Research and Quality (AHRQ) Quality Indicators (QIs) are
one Agency response to this need for a multidimensional, accessible family of quality indicators.
They include a family of measures that providers, policy makers, and researchers can use with
inpatient data to identify apparent variations in the quality of either inpatient or outpatient care.
The PQI composites provide:
-Provide assessment of quality and disparity
-Provide baselines to track progress
-Identify information gaps
-Emphasize interdependence of quality and disparities
-Promote awareness and change
What AHRQ PQI Composite Measure:
PQI #01 Diabetes Short-Term Complications Admission Rate
PQI #03 Diabetes Long-Term Complications Admission Rate
PQI #05 Chronic Obstructive Pulmonary Disease (COPD) or Asthma in Older Adults Admission Rate
PQI #07 Hypertension Admission Rate
PQI #08 Congestive Heart Failure (CHF) Admission Rate
PQI #10 Dehydration Admission Rate
PQI #11 Bacterial Pneumonia Admission Rate
PQI #12 Urinary Tract Infection Admission Rate
PQI #13 Angina without Procedure Admission Rate
PQI #14 Uncontrolled Diabetes Admission Rate
PQI #15 Asthma in Younger Adults Admission Rate
PQI #16 Rate of Lower-Extremity Amputation Among Patients With Diabetes
Acute Composite (PQI #91)
PQI #10 Dehydration Admission Rate
PQI #11 Bacterial Pneumonia Admission Rate
PQI #12 Urinary Tract Infection Admission Rate
Chronic Composite (PQI #92)
PQI #01 Diabetes Short-Term Complications Admission Rate
PQI #03 Diabetes Long-Term Complications Admission Rate
PQI #05 Chronic Obstructive Pulmonary Disease (COPD) or Asthma in Older Adults Admission Rate
PQI #07 Hypertension Admission Rate
PQI #08 Congestive Heart Failure (CHF) Admission Rate
PQI #13 Angina without Procedure Admission Rate
PQI #14 Uncontrolled Diabetes Admission Rate
PQI #15 Asthma in Younger Adults Admission Rate
PQI #16 Rate of Lower-Extremity Amputation Among Patients With Diabetes
